Industrial solar panels represent a revolutionary energy solution designed specifically for large-scale commercial and manufacturing operations. These high-performance photovoltaic systems convert sunlight into electricity through advanced silicon cell technology, delivering substantial power output to meet demanding industrial energy requirements. Unlike residential solar installations, industrial solar panel systems feature robust construction materials and enhanced durability ratings to withstand harsh operational environments including extreme temperatures, chemical exposure, and mechanical stress. The primary function of an industrial solar panel involves capturing solar radiation through semiconductor materials that generate direct current electricity when exposed to photons. This electricity flows through integrated inverter systems that convert DC power to alternating current, making it compatible with standard industrial electrical infrastructure. Modern industrial solar panel designs incorporate anti-reflective coatings, tempered glass surfaces, and corrosion-resistant aluminum frames that ensure optimal performance across diverse climatic conditions. These systems typically generate power outputs ranging from 400 to 600 watts per panel, with efficiency ratings exceeding 20 percent in premium models. Industrial solar panel installations commonly serve manufacturing facilities, warehouses, data centers, mining operations, and agricultural processing plants. The modular design allows for scalable deployment across expansive roof areas or ground-mounted configurations spanning multiple acres. Advanced monitoring systems integrated within industrial solar panel networks provide real-time performance analytics, enabling facility managers to optimize energy production and identify maintenance requirements. Temperature coefficients in industrial solar panel specifications ensure consistent power generation even during peak summer conditions, while low-light performance characteristics maintain electricity production during overcast weather patterns. The technological sophistication of industrial solar panel systems includes bypass diodes that prevent power losses from partial shading and maximum power point tracking capabilities that continuously adjust electrical parameters for optimal energy harvest throughout varying weather conditions.
